✉️Thank you for the invite! ✏️After receiving a bundle of letters from Fane Street Primary pupils last year, The Queen popped into the school to meet staff, students, and join their assembly. 🌍The school is a vibrant and welcoming community, with 285 pupils representing 45 countries and speaking an impressive 47 different languages.
